What This Means (2025 FDD)
According to Lees Famous Recipe's 2025 Franchise Disclosure Document, franchisees are required to remodel their restaurant as a condition of renewal. To renew their franchise agreement for an additional 15-year term, a franchisee must meet several requirements.
Among these requirements, the franchisee must provide advance notice of their intent to renew, not be in default within the 24 months preceding the expiration of the initial term, and comply with the current Franchise Agreement. They must also satisfactorily complete any new or refresher training programs and sign a new agreement, which may contain materially different terms and conditions than the original agreement.
Critically, the franchisee must provide proof that they will maintain possession of the restaurant premises and remodel the restaurant as necessary to comply with Lees Famous Recipe's then-current standards and specifications. Additionally, they must pay a renewal fee and sign a general release of claims. This means that a significant investment in remodeling may be necessary to keep the franchise up-to-date and in compliance with the brand's evolving image and operational standards.
